Why Submit an Unsolicited Application in the Electronic Equipment Repair Service Sector?
Many companies in the electronic equipment repair service sector do not always advertise open positions. By submitting an unsolicited application, you can showcase your enthusiasm and initiative. This proactive approach demonstrates your genuine interest in the company and may place you at the forefront of the hiring pool when a position becomes available.
- Access hidden job markets
- Demonstrate initiative and enthusiasm
- Build a professional network
What Skills and Qualities Are Essential in the Electronic Equipment Repair Service?
To apply electronic equipment repair service positions effectively, you need a specific set of skills and qualities. Employers are looking for technical expertise combined with soft skills.
- Technical Skills: Proficiency in diagnostics, soldering, circuit analysis
- Problem-Solving: Ability to troubleshoot and resolve issues efficiently
- Attention to Detail: Precision in repair work to ensure quality
- Communication Skills: Clear communication with clients and team members

Common Mistakes to Absolutely Avoid
Even the most qualified candidates can make mistakes that hinder their chances. Avoid these pitfalls:
- Sending generic applications to multiple companies
- Overlooking typos and grammatical errors
- Failing to follow up after submission
